

Sawah Atong is an open rice-field landscape near Atong village offering layered paddies, irrigation channels and reflective water surfaces—great for patterns, leading lines and local rural scenes. Best at sunrise or late afternoon for warm sidelighting and reflections; after rain or during planting season yields strongest water mirrors. Site is roadside-accessible from Aceh Besar with informal parking; expect basic rural paths and to respect working farmers—ask permission before close-up shots.
